One dealer was even questioned and replied that the letters didn't touch making it a wide AM
Wow, that is really a clueless dealer that doesn't understand the minting process. Not touching doesn't make it the wide variety- the separation can be increased slightly due to die polishing/abrading to remove clashes and other die flaws but it will still not look like a
Wide AM. The easiest way to compare wide vs. normal is to look at a proof cent from that particular year
